Andiamo Gourmet Deli

649 Diamond Street
San Francisco California, 94114
Phone: (415) 282-0081
Website:
Specialty: Italian
Cuisine: European, Italian
Feature: Dining, 24 Hours, Hotel Dining
Price: On Budget Prices
Feedback: 5